Summary: | Hydroponic cultivations are practiced in greenhouse or different plat factories. pH and electrical conductivity are commonly used to evaluate this type of farming. It may not deliver detailed information about any imbalances detected during the cultivation process. This results in a low yield or waste of resources. As a result, in order to overcome these constraints, in this cultivation process, an IoT measuring system must be installed, where actuators and sensors might assess the appropriate readings when needed and provided to human power. As a result, by constantly monitoring resources devoted to plant cultivation, an imbalance in nutrient acquisition is eliminated. This makes it easier for farmers to deal with nutrient concerns that arise during growing. The designed system's performance was computed in conjunction with the viability of an IoT framework for automated assessments. The results of the model are calculated and checked before being used in further processing. When there is no unique association among the standardized analyses, several specific metrics are explored. The sensitive responses are investigated and studied. |
